我一直在Windows中使用PyLint,配置如下:

pylint \
    --good-names ('i','el','of','df','pd','Entity') \
    --bad-names ('foo','bar','kek','KEK') \
    module

但在Ubuntu上,我在try 解析好名字参数('i','el', ...)时遇到了一个异常:

/bin/bash: -c: line 6: syntax error near unexpected token `('

在ubuntu上提供这种不同寻常的争论的正确方式是什么?

推荐答案

您应该用引号将元组括起来:

pylint \
    --good-names "('i','el','of','df','pd','Entity')" \
    --bad-names "('foo','bar','kek','KEK')" \
    module

Python相关问答推荐

遵循轮廓中对象方向的计算线

opencv Python稳定的图标识别

按照行主要蛇扫描顺序对点列表进行排序

如何在Python中使用io.BytesIO写入现有缓冲区?

2维数组9x9,不使用numpy.数组(MutableSequence的子类)

即使在可见的情况下也不相互作用

将特定列信息移动到当前行下的新行

为什么这个带有List输入的简单numba函数这么慢

在Polars(Python库)中将二进制转换为具有非UTF-8字符的字符串变量

大小为M的第N位_计数(或人口计数)的公式

Godot:需要碰撞的对象的AdditionerBody2D或Area2D以及queue_free?

Pandas计数符合某些条件的特定列的数量

我的字符串搜索算法的平均时间复杂度和最坏时间复杂度是多少?

pysnmp—lextudio使用next()和getCmd()生成器导致TypeError:tuple对象不是迭代器''

用两个字符串构建回文

根据Pandas中带条件的两个列的值创建新列

我什么时候应该使用帆布和标签?

为什么dict. items()可以快速查找?

如何在Polars中创建条件增量列?

极点用特定值替换前n行